RevolverGuy Ritchie has got a lot to answer for.

He’s more famous these days for being the husband of that tiny American who fell off a horse. But he’s also made some shocking films in his time. Most notably, Swept Away - a film so clenchingly dreadful that they wouldn’t even show it in cinemas - but his other films weren’t up to much either.

Lock Stock And Two Smoking Barrels was solely responsible for the miserable film career of Vinnie Jones, while Snatch was such a shame-faced rip-off of the first film that it seemed pointless making it in the first place.

On September 22nd, a new Guy Ritchie film - entitled Revolver - will hit your local multiplex. And this one actually looks pretty good. It appears that Ritchie has binned all the schoolboy geezer talk to make an intelligent-looking British gangster film. It stars Jason Statham, Andre Benjamin from Outkast and - best of all - Vice City hero Ray Liotta.

We’ve got our fingers crossed for Revolver, and today we’re letting you watch a weird little microclip of it.
